速生樹種木材製造粒片板之研究(IV-4)-聚脲酯膠合劑之聚乙二醇與聚異氰酸鹽混合比對粒片板性質之影響

Studies on the Manufacturing of Particleboard from Fast-Growing Tree Species (IV-4)-Effect of Mix Ratio of Polyethylene Glycol (PEG) and Polymeric Diphenymethane Diisocyanate (PMDI) of Polyurethane (PU) Glue on the Properties of Particleboard

摘要


以多元醇(Polyol)之聚乙二醇(Polyethylene glycol, PEG)與聚異氰酸鹽膠(Polymeric diphenymethane diisocyanate, PMDI)不同重量混合比(0:100;5:95;20:80;35:65;50:50)作為膠合劑,製造密度0.45 g/cm^3之泡桐粒片板;其靜曲破壞強度(MOR)、內聚力(IB)、木螺絲釘保持力(SH)及尺寸安定性質,均以混合比5:95者為最佳。

並列摘要


Using Polyethylene Glycol (PEG, molecular weight 1000), one kind of polyol, mixed with Isocyanate (PMDI, polymeric diphenymethane diisocyanate) as glue, their 5 kinds of mix ratio were 0:100, 5:95, 20:80, 35:65 and 50:50. the density of particleboard was 0.45 g/cm^3 and made from Paulownia×taiwaniana. Its modulus of rupture (MOR), internal bonding (IB), screw holding strength (SH) and dimensional stability showed the glue mix ratio at 5:95 the best.
